CFC, or CarFilmComponents, a vinyl wrap specialist from Germany, revealed today their latest project, which is based on the 2011 Ford Mustang. The CFC Ford Mustang is powered by the 5.0-liter V8 engine, which has been upgraded to 435 hp and mated to a 6-speed manual transmission. The extra horsepowers come from a new air filter and a re-mapped engine control unit. CFC's Mustang sits on 8,5x20 inch wheels and 255/35ZR20 tires on the front axle and 10x20 inch rims and 285/30ZR20 rubber on the rear one. CFC also equipped their new Mustang with an aftermarket H&R suspension system. The CFC Ford Mustang is based on the black car, which received a metallic orange and white vinyl wrap, together with a carbon fiber foil. CFC prices their new Ford Mustang package at 12.150,00 EUR.
